Lower Financial Burden

One of the biggest benefits of it is that it lowers the financial burden on individuals. Buying a property on one's own can be a daunting task, especially given the high prices of real estate. However, with it, individuals can share the financial burden with another person. This means that the down payment, EMIs, and other expenses related to owning a property can be shared, making it more affordable.

Higher Loan Eligibility

Another advantage of joint ownership is that it increases an individual's loan eligibility. Banks and financial institutions consider the combined income of all the co-owners when deciding on the loan amount. This means that if two individuals buy a property together, they can avail of a higher loan amount than if they were to apply for a loan individually.

Tax Benefits

Joint ownership also offers several tax benefits to co-owners. Both co-owners can claim a tax deduction on the interest paid on the home loan, provided they are both paying for the loan. Additionally, co-owners can also claim tax deductions on the principal amount repaid under Section 80C of the Income Tax Act.
